Obrigado @Andrew_Rowe pela dica!
Não, não preciso de uma conexão vinda de fora da minha LAN para testar.
Então, executei install-discourse com --skip-connection-test e, como esperado, a instalação prosseguiu sem travar na verificação do domínio.
É importante lembrar de parar o nginx se ele já estiver rodando (fora do Docker).
Mas está tudo certo! O Discourse está rodando dentro do seu container!
Porém… aparentemente, agora temos um problema com o certificado.
nginx: [emerg] cannot load certificate “/shared/ssl/forum.mondomaine.me.cer”: PEM_read_bio_X509_AUX() failed (SSL: error:0480006C:PEM routines::no start line:Expecting: TRUSTED CERTIFICATE)
Claro, segui este tópico e verifiquei a existência de /var/discourse/shared/ssl/forum.mondomaine.me.cer, e está tudo certo, assim como o .key e os outros dois arquivos em .me_ecc.cer|key.
Reconstruí o container, mas o problema persiste.
Posso confirmar que instalar o Discourse em uma máquina de teste local é um verdadeiro desafio! ![]()
Parece que isso não é incentivado.
E, na falta de uma solução simples (não, não usarei o CloudFlare, não adianta seguir por esse caminho, obrigado), acho que será minha última mensagem sobre o assunto. ![]()